
Epigallocatechin gallate(EGCG) stands as a prominent polyphenol abundant in green tea, renowned for its potent antioxidant properties and numerous health benefits. Beyond its role as a dietary supplement, EGCG has found its way into the food industry due to its multifunctional attributes and diverse applications. In this comprehensive exploration, we will delve into the composition, functions, uses, and significance of EGCG in the fascinating world of food production, preservation, and enhancement.
Epigallocatechin gallate (EGCG) belongs to a class of compounds known as catechins, which are flavonoids found primarily in green tea. Chemically, EGCG is a polyphenolic compound characterized by its antioxidant potential and numerous health-promoting properties. It exhibits a molecular structure consisting of multiple hydroxyl (OH) groups and gallate esters.
